    OK, I used transporter to migrate the data from a Dell tower into Parallels... this seems to have worked perfectly. The problem I am having is activation.

    I assumed I would have a problem migrating an OEM copy of windows that came with the Dell so I bought a retail box of Windows XP Pro and tried to use that Product ID to activate Windows that I just migrated... but it won't work. Says I mistyped or something, I've tried to call MS but have been disconnected twice from their tech support in India.

    Is there anyway to do a repair install of windows under parallels to fix the activation? Any assistance would be great!

    Just choose to activate over the phone. That generates a bunch of numbers. Call the microsoft telephone number given in the activation window! You may get automated prompts lead to live technician. you may have to give these numbers from the activation window for them to activate your copy of windows! Good luck!
